unified processor with support for parsing Latin-script natural language as input and serializing it as output.

Contents

What is this?

This package is a unified processor with support for parsing Latin-script natural language as input and serializing it as output by using unified with retext-latin and retext-stringify.

See the monorepo readme for info on what the retext ecosystem is.

When should I use this?

You can use this package when you want to use unified, have Latin-script as input, and as output. This package is a shortcut for unified().use(retextLatin).use(retextStringify). When the input isn’t Latin-script (meaning you don’t need retext-latin), it’s recommended to use unified directly.

Install

This package is ESM only. In Node.js (version 12.20+, 14.14+, 16.0+, or 18.0+), install with npm:

npm install retext

In Deno with esm.sh:

import {retext} from 'https://esm.sh/retext@8'

In browsers with esm.sh:

<script type="module">
  import {retext} from 'https://esm.sh/retext@8?bundle'
</script>

Use

import {reporter} from 'vfile-reporter'
import {retext} from 'retext'
import retextProfanities from 'retext-profanities'
import retextEmoji from 'retext-emoji'

const file = await retext()
  .use(retextProfanities)
  .use(retextEmoji, {convert: 'encode'})
  .process('He’s set on beating your butt for sheriff! :cop:')

console.log(String(file))
console.error(reporter(file))

Yields:

He’s set on beating your butt for sheriff! 👮
  1:26-1:30  warning  Be careful with “butt”, it’s profane in some cases  butt  retext-profanities

⚠ 1 warning

API

This package exports the identifier retext. There is no default export.

retext()

Create a new (unfrozen) unified processor that already uses retext-latin and retext-stringify and you can add more plugins to. See unified for more information.

Syntax tree

The syntax tree format used in retext is nlcst.

Types

This package is fully typed with TypeScript. There are no extra exported types.

Compatibility

Projects maintained by the unified collective are compatible with all maintained versions of Node.js. As of now, that is Node.js 12.20+, 14.14+, 16.0+, and 18.0+. Our projects sometimes work with older versions, but this is not guaranteed.
